Azul vs Zamboanga City Climate & Distance Between

Philippines flag
  • The distance between Azul, Argentina and Zamboanga City, Philippines is approximately 16,693 km or 10,373 mi.
  • To reach Azul in this distance one would set out from Zamboanga City bearing 177° or S and follow the great circles arc to approach Azul bearing 3.8° or N .
  • Azul has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Zamboanga City has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• The mean temperature is 12.8 °C (23°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 13.1 °C (23.6°F) more in Azul.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 93.4 mm (3.7 in) less which is equivalent to 93.4 l/m² (2.29 US gal/ft²) or 934,000 l/ha (99,851 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21.6° lower in Azul than in Zamboanga City.
  • Relative humidity levels are 2.6%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 13.8°C (24.8°F) lower.
